18.1.133.2 Ramp function generator

The PID output is led via a ramp function generator with linear characteristic. This serves to transfer

setpoint step-changes at the PID output into a ramp which should be as steep as possible.

18.1.133.3 Operating range of the PID process controller

The value range of the input signal nSet_a and thus the operating range of the PID process controller

can be limited with the following parameters:

C00231/1

: Pos. maximum (default setting: 199.99 %)

C00231/2

: Pos. minimum (default setting: 0.00 %)

C00231/3

: Neg. minimum (default setting: 0.00 %)

C00231/4

: Neg. maximum (default setting: 199.99 %)
